This match was drawn. Rain prevented play after lunch on the second day, and the game was abandoned at 3.45 pm. For Northamptonshire, there was 1 five and 14 fours in Horton's 97, 2 fives and 6 fours in East's 79, and 10 fours in H E Kingston's 66. There were two century partnerships in the Northamptonshire innings with H E Kingston and Thompson adding 105 runs for the second wicket, and East and Horton 157 for the seventh. For Northumberland, Mortimer top-scored with 61 not out. When scoring his second run in the Northamptonshire innings, Colson reached the career milestone of one thousand runs in the Championship.
